Akram
Akram (Arabic: أکرم ), is used as a given name and surname, and is derived from the Arabic root word Karam (Arabic: كرم), meaning generosity. In the Arabic language, it means "most generous." Akram is closely related to the words Karim and Kareem, meaning generous.
